Across the available record, Doubletree by Hilton has 11 inspections on file, the first dated 2023. The most recent visit was on Nov 14, 2025. Low risk indicates the latest report didn't flag anything that would worry the average customer.

Recent inspections have found fewer violations than earlier ones, averaging around one violation lately and about 18 violations before that.

The pattern that stands out is “spray bottle containing toxic substance not labeled”, which has been cited five times.

The city-wide average for Jacksonville sits at 74, putting Doubletree by Hilton on the better side of that line. The file should reassure diners considering a visit.
